sql中单引号的问题
上一篇 /
下一篇 2009-04-07 09:38:31
/ 个人分类:Mysql
sql中单引号的问题
如果插入一条记录,记录值中包含了单引号,那么应该怎么处理?
比如说 insert into a values ('ab'c');
这种写法肯定有问题。
那么insert into a values ("ab'c");也是不对。
真正有用的是:
insert into a values ('ab''c');
这里用两个单引号表示一个。
相关阅读:
- 大内存SQLServer数据库的加速剂 (fishy, 2009-2-25)
- SQL数据库管理系统知识复习 (coffeetea2008, 2009-2-27)
- 测试SQL Server业务规则链接方法 (51testing, 2009-3-03)
- 如何批量插入上万条数据? (雪纯子, 2009-3-04)
- 在SQL Server中使用别名用户时的安全问题 (fishy, 2009-3-09)
- 构造SQL Server安全门 (51testing, 2009-3-11)
- QTP:不同数据库检查点手动SQL写法 (fishy, 2009-3-12)
- 并行查询让SQL Server加速运行 (51testing, 2009-3-17)
- 六个建议防止SQL注入式攻击 (fishy, 2009-3-26)
- 六个建议防止SQL注入式攻击 (wangpl4092, 2009-3-27)
收藏
举报
TAG:
SQL
sql
单引号